Le'Kiesha French Merritt is a visionary in Global economic development, tech, entrepreneurship & innovation ecosystem building with over two decades of transformative impact. She founded two global multi-million-dollar social enterprises and has helped shape technology ecosystems worldwide through her work within Silicon Valley and international institutions like Georgia Institute of Technology, MIT, Standard and HBCUs. Today, she leads as Founder & President of The Future in Color Institute and Future In Color Media, driving corporate innovation and championing diversity in innovation ecosystems.
Le'Kiesha is pioneering the Global Black GDP(x) project, using a data-driven approach to forecast wealth by 2050 and create an inclusive economic future. Her advocacy extends to critical areas like Black women’s health, maternal health, and criminal justice reform, making her a beacon for change-makers worldwide.
